Bugs for Lunch, by Margery Facklam and illustrated by Sylvia Long. Learn all about bugs and their importance in the food chain! This book won a Parenting Magazine Reading Magic Award. Beautiful watercolor illustrations of bugs, animals, and people too. 

This book was donated by the Canyonlands Natural History Association. Chartered in 1967 as a 501(c)(3), CNHA works in partnership to operate stores at Arches National Park, Canyonlands National Park, Natural Bridges National Monument, Hovenweep National Monument, the Canyons of the Ancients Visitor Center and Museum, Cedar Mesa and Grand Gulch Primitive Area, Bears Ears National Monument, Manti-La Sal National Forest, and the Blanding Information Center. CNHA also staffs the Moab Information Center, the official multi-agency information center for southeastern Utah providing one-stop-shopping for area books, guides, maps and gift items, which are also available through the Canyonlands Natural History Association online store.
